- : Sorry if this sounds simple,
- : I have SCO Unix 3.2.2 with ODT 1.0.1 and I'm considering updating to
- : SCO Unix 3.2.4 just so I can compile X11R5. My applications at present are
- : running under the X11R3 and Motif 1.0 from the development system. But if I
- > upgrade at a large cost and compile X11R5 will my Motif release still be compatible ?? Is this worth the trouble ??
-
- Upgrading to ODT 2.0 will get you up to X11R4 as well as updating
- the OS to 3.2v4.
-
- : One more thing ... How come SCO's Open Desktop still only supports X11R3 ???
-
- ODT 2.0 is now at X11R4, how come you're still running 1.1 :-)?
-
- More seriously, SCO's primary consideration is producing a solid
- product for commercial use, and it takes a while to test, debug,
- and document it for the masses. I heard at SCO Forum last month
- that ODT 2.1 will include X11R5.
